This darling pyjama monkey with one hand bitten off – by goodness knows who! – has now gone to a new home.

A pyjama monkey has a zipper in his back and in the morning you stuffed him with your PJs and he lay on your bed all day waiting for you to come back to bed.

He lived with me for a while and now he is going to live with Karen!
